The Lunar Reconnaissance Orbiter Camera (LROC) Experiment Data Record Wide Angle Camera – Color (EDRWAC) data product is a WAC 7-band color image corresponding to a series of framelets, with Digital Number (DN) counts in 8-bit format, companded from 11-bit in the instrument. Each framelet is in row-major order. The EDRWAC stores multispectral framelets in a single band.
The WAC has two lenses imaging onto the same 1024 x 1024 pixel, electronically shuttered CCD area-array, one image in the visible/near infrared (VIS), and the other in the Ultraviolet (UV). In color mode, only the center 704 x 14 visible pixels and 512 x 16 UV pixels binned to 128 x 4 pixels, are read out for each band (320 nm, 360 nm, 415 nm, 565 nm, 605 nm, 645 nm, and 690 nm).
The image file consists of frames in row-major order with a 4 byte validity marker separating each frame. If compression was enabled at image acquisition, the data stream is first decompressed before further processing is performed. Information from the meta-file, housekeeping, and the SOC database are combined to generate the PDS label that combined with the binary data to produce the EDR file.
Specifications for the Color WAC are in the table below.
| Visible | UV | |||||||||||||||||||||
FOV | 61.4° | 58.96° | |||||||||||||||||||||
IFOV | 1.498 mrad | 7.67 mrad (4x4 binned) | |||||||||||||||||||||
Image scale (nadir, 50 km altitude) | 74.9 m/pixel | 383.5 m/pixel (binned) | |||||||||||||||||||||
Image frame width | 59.6 km | 56.8 km | |||||||||||||||||||||
Image format (each band) | 704 samples x 14 lines | 128 samples x 4 lines (binned) | |||||||||||||||||||||
f/# (Ritchey-Chretien) | 5.052 | 5.65 | |||||||||||||||||||||
Effective focal length | 6.013 mm | 4.693 mm | |||||||||||||||||||||
Entrance pupil diameter | 1.19 mm | 0.85 mm | |||||||||||||||||||||
System MTF (Nyquist) | 0.37 | ||||||||||||||||||||||
Gain | 25.9 ± 0.7 e-/DN | ||||||||||||||||||||||
Noise | 66 ± 4 e- | ||||||||||||||||||||||
Detector fullwell | 46,100 ± 3600 e- | ||||||||||||||||||||||

SNR (at 1000 DN) | > 150 | ||||||||||||||||||||||
Detector digitization | 11-bit, encoded to 8-bits | ||||||||||||||||||||||
Lossless compression ratio | 1.7:1 | ||||||||||||||||||||||
Electronics | 4 circuit boards | ||||||||||||||||||||||
Detector | Kodak KLA-1001 | ||||||||||||||||||||||
Pixel format | 1,024 x 1,024 | ||||||||||||||||||||||
Voltage | 28 ± 7V DC | ||||||||||||||||||||||
Peak power | 2.7 W | ||||||||||||||||||||||
Orbit average power | 2.6 W | ||||||||||||||||||||||
Mass | 0.9 kg | ||||||||||||||||||||||
Volume (width x length x height) | 15.8 cm x 23.2 cm x 32.3 cm (incl. radiator) |
LROC EDRWAC products have the following file names:
tnnnnnnnnnCE.IMG
where:
t = target
M = Moon
E = Earth
C = calibration
S = star
nnnnnnnnn = 9-digit Mission Elapsed Time of acquisition (with a single digit for partition which denotes a reset of the MET)
